How long does it take to become a full time cabin safety inspector?

Becoming a full-time cabin safety inspector typically requires completing relevant training, which can take several weeks to a few months, and gaining experience in aviation safety or customer service. Some positions may also require certification or specialized knowledge of safety protocols, with additional on-the-job training provided by employers.

What is a full time cabin safety inspector?

A full-time cabin safety inspector is responsible for ensuring the safety and compliance of aircraft cabins with federal regulations. They conduct inspections, identify safety issues, and verify that safety equipment and procedures are properly maintained, often requiring certification and knowledge of aviation safety standards.

Job description

Description

 The successful candidate will be responsible for Flight Attendant duties on each trip. 

Other duties may include aircraft interior cleaning, managing the stock on board the aircraft, passenger check-in, baggage handling, and assisting passengers as necessary.

Serve as primary Cabin Crew member on authorized Pentastar Aviation flights. 

Maintain complete knowledge of cabin flight safety procedures.

Determine in-flight food service needs, organize catering, and ensure aircraft provisioning.

Perform in-flight cabin services, prepare, and serve meals and refreshments, provide comfort assistance and generally facilitate the flight for passengers.

Adhere to Pentastar Aviation security regulations.

Contact crew scheduler to obtain future flight schedules.

Submit operating and expense reports in a timely manner.

Be fully knowledgeable of the Pentastar Aviation General Operating Procedures manual.

Conduct assignments in a professional manner. Be a positive representative of Pentastar Aviation.

This position will be located at DTW/PTK. The individual selected for this position must live within 2 hours of the Base of Operations.
